Abstract

The invention provides an IP library correction method, an IP library correction device, a server and a storage medium, wherein the method comprises the following steps: judging whether the network transmission quality of the target IP used by the target user meets the trigger condition; when the trigger condition is met, inquiring whether a use record of at least one reference IP used by the target user within a preset time exists, wherein the at least one reference IP and the target IP are in different IP subnets, and the geographical position of the target user within the preset time is not changed; and if the use record exists, correcting the attribution information of the target IP according to the attribution information of the at least one reference IP. The method corrects the target IP by using the reference IP attribution information of the IP subnet different from the target IP, thereby effectively and quickly correcting the attribution information aiming at the IP with poor network transmission quality.

Background
The service system usually searches the home information of the IP, including the home location and the home business businessman, in the outsourcing IP library according to the IP address of the user, and then instructs the user to access the server matched with the IP. If a user accesses a server that does not match the IP, its access quality and network transmission quality can be greatly affected. And only if the IP attribution information recorded in the IP library is accurate, the user can access the matched server. In an actual scenario, the service system indicates that the user accesses a server which is not matched according to the IP information before update because the IP replaces the home location or the operator and the IP library is not updated in time, which reduces the user experience. The IP library has huge data amount and cannot be manually calibrated one by one, and a method for correcting and calibrating the IP library in time does not exist in the prior art.

Referring to fig. 1, the application scenario of the IP library correction method provided by the present invention is shown. The service system 120, such as a live system, a video conference system, etc., includes an access server 121, an IP library 122, a service server 123, and an IP verification system 124. Wherein the access server 121 may receive an access request of the user 110 and query the IP repository 122 for home information of the IP, including home and home operator information, based on the IP address of the user 110. The access server 121 then assigns the service server 123 matching the IP to the user 110 based on the home information of the IP. If the IP home location of subscriber 110 is cantonese and the home carrier is mobile, subscriber 110 is assigned a service server 123 located in or closest to cantonese that serves the mobile carrier. The access server 121 instructs the user 110 to access the service server 123, and the service server 123 may provide service services, such as live video and video conference, to the user 110. The user 110 can only be guaranteed access quality and network transmission quality if he has access to the service server 123 that matches the IP he uses. Therefore, only if the accuracy of the IP home information stored in the IP repository 122 is correct, the access server 121 can assign the user 110 to the service server 123 matching the IP address.
In an actual scenario, the service system indicates that the user accesses a server which is not matched according to the IP information before updating because the home location or the operator is replaced by the IP address and the IP library is not updated in time, which reduces the user experience. If a certain IP is replaced by a connected operator from a mobile operator, but the IP library 122 does not update the information of the IP after the replacement, when the user 110 uses the IP, the access server 121 will still assign the service server 123 serving the mobile operator to the user, obviously, the access quality and the network transmission quality of the mobile server are greatly reduced by accessing the mobile server with the home connected IP.
In order to solve the above problem, in the present invention, when the service server 123 uses the IP, the service server 123 may also count network transmission quality data between the user 110 and the service server 123, such as a packet loss rate and a delay rate, and report the network transmission quality data of the IP to the IP verification system 124, and the IP verification system 124 triggers a correction method of the IP library according to the received network transmission quality data, where the IP verification system 124 may be an independent server or a functional module in the service server 123, and the present invention is not limited herein. The IP library correction method is specifically shown in fig. 2, and includes the steps of:
step 210: judging whether the network transmission quality of the target IP used by the target user meets the trigger condition;
step 220: when the trigger condition is met, inquiring whether a use record of at least one reference IP used by the target user within a preset time exists, wherein the at least one reference IP and the target IP are in different IP subnets, and the geographical position of the target user within the preset time is not changed;
step 230: and if the use record exists, correcting the attribution information of the target IP according to the attribution information of the at least one reference IP.
According to the IP library correction method provided by the invention, based on the fact that the geographical position of the target user is not changed within the preset time, when the network transmission quality of the target user using the target IP meets the trigger condition, the target IP is corrected by using the reference IP attribution information of the IP which is in different IP subnets with the target IP, so that the attribution information correction can be effectively and quickly carried out on the IP with poor network transmission quality.
Generally, the geographic location of the user 110 does not change during a certain period of time, such as a day, where the geographic location is at a city granularity, i.e., the user 110 will typically only be active in one city during a day. And the user 110 will typically use a different IP address to connect to the service system 120 in a different scenario. For example, IP-1 may be used when a cell phone is used to connect to a service server on a commute, IP-2 may be used in a work unit, and IP-3 may be used at home. The operator may also assign the same address to different users at different time periods, for example, for IP-1, the operator may assign the same address to a certain user at a certain time period in the morning, and when the user is used up, the operator may recover IP-1 and reassign the IP-1 to another user who needs to access the internet. I.e. the user is random in using the IP connection service server. But since user 110 does not change its geographic location within a certain time, the IP home used by the user is the same during that time. The above characteristics can perform multi-dimensional analysis and judgment on the attribution information of one IP. In some embodiments, the geographic location of the target user is changed within a preset time in step 220. The preset time may be one day, and the geographic location may be in a granularity of a city, that is, the target user does not go to other cities within the preset time, that is, the geographic location of the target user is considered to have not changed.
Based on the above conditions, it is first determined whether the network transmission quality of the target user satisfies the trigger condition when the target user uses the target IP. The network transmission quality may be characterized by at least one of a delay rate and a packet loss rate. When the network transmission quality is characterized by a delay rate, the trigger condition may include that the delay rate is greater than a delay threshold, which may be 100 milliseconds; when the network transmission quality is characterized by the packet loss rate, the triggering condition may include that the packet loss rate is greater than a packet loss threshold, and the packet loss threshold may be 5-10%; the network transmission quality may also be characterized by a delay rate and a packet loss rate, and the triggering condition may include that the delay rate is greater than a delay threshold, and the packet loss rate is greater than a delay threshold.
When the network transmission quality of the target IP used by the target user meets the trigger condition, whether a use record of at least one reference IP used by the target user in a preset time exists is inquired, and the at least one reference IP and the target IP are in different IP subnets. An operator will typically divide its IP segment into multiple IP subnets. As mentioned above, the same user may use different IP addresses within a certain time, and the operator may assign IP to the user randomly. All the IPs used by the user in a certain time may be the same IP subnet or different IP subnets, but considering that the storage of the IP home information in the IP library is often based on the IP subnet as granularity, that is, the home information of the IP of the same subnet is the same, and based on that the geographic location of the user in a certain time does not change, that is, the home information of the IP used in a certain time is consistent, when the network transmission quality of the target IP used by the target user meets the trigger condition, that is, the quality is poor, the target IP can be corrected by referring to the reference IP in other IP subnets used by the target user.
If there is the usage record that the target user uses at least one reference IP within the preset time, in some embodiments, it may be determined whether the attribution information of the reference IP is completely consistent with the attribution information of the target IP, and if not, the attribution information of the target IP is modified according to the attribution information of the at least one reference IP. In some embodiments, the priority of the reference IP may be selected according to the network transmission quality determination, such as determining the priority of the reference IP from high to low according to the order of the network transmission quality from good to bad. And then selecting the attribution information of the reference IP according to the priority from high to low to correct the attribution information of the target IP so that the network transmission quality of the corrected target IP does not meet the triggering condition. In some embodiments, after selecting the first priority, i.e. the reference IP with the highest priority, the attribution information of the first priority reference IP may be stored as the first standby attribution information of the target IP. After the target IP uses the first standby attribution information, if the network transmission quality of the target IP does not meet the triggering condition any more, namely the quality is improved, the attribution information of the target IP is modified into the first standby attribution information. If the target IP still meets the trigger condition after the first standby attribution information is used, namely the quality is not improved, the attribution information is not the reason of poor transmission quality of the target IP network, and therefore the attribution information of the target IP is restored to the original attribution information.
However, in some scenarios, the target IP does not have a better network quality after using the first alternative home information, possibly because the home operator of the first alternative home information is different from the home operator of the target IP. As in the above example, user 110 may use IP-1, IP-2, and IP-3 with the same home location, but their home merchants may all be different, e.g., IP-1 with mobile home, IP-2 with Unicom, and IP-3 with mobile home. However, the home business that records IP-1 in the IP library is telecom, so the network transmission quality is poor when the user 110 uses IP-1, and the IP-2 and IP-3 are selected as reference IPs when the triggering condition is met. When the network transmission quality of IP-2 is better than that of IP-3, the attribution information of IP-1 is corrected according to the attribution information of IP-2. But since the home business of IP-2 is connected, the network quality of the modified IP-1 will not improve. Therefore, in some embodiments, after the target IP uses the first standby attribution information, the target IP still satisfies the above triggering condition, that is, the quality is not improved, except that the attribution information of the target IP is restored to the original attribution information, the reference IP after the first priority can be sequentially selected according to the priorities from high to low to modify the attribution information of the target IP, so that the network transmission quality of the modified target IP does not satisfy the triggering condition. If IP-1 does not get better after using the attribution information of IP-2 as in the above example, the attribution information of IP-3 can be selected to correct the attribution information of IP-1. Because the home business of IP-3 is mobile, the network transmission quality can be improved after IP-1 is modified, and the triggering condition is not satisfied any more.
The above is an embodiment provided when there is a usage record for the target user to use at least one reference IP within a preset time.
When the usage record does not exist, the client corresponding to the target user can be indicated to ping at least one reference server according to the attribution information of the target IP; and according to the attribution information of the at least one reference server, correcting the attribution information of the target IP. Wherein the home information of the reference server is different from the home information of the target IP. If the attribution information of the target IP is Guangzhou Mobile, the reference server can be a server serving Guangzhou Unicom, Guangzhou Telecommunications, Shenzhen Mobile, or the like. And correcting the attribution information of the target IP according to the network transmission quality fed back to the client by the at least one reference server. In some embodiments, the priority of selecting the reference server may be determined according to the network transmission quality, such as determining the priority of the reference server from high to low in the order of the network transmission quality from good to bad. And then selecting the attribution information of the reference server in sequence from high to low according to the priority to correct the attribution information of the target IP, so that the network transmission quality of the corrected target IP does not meet the triggering condition. In some embodiments, after selecting the reference server with the first priority, i.e. the highest priority, the home information of the first priority reference server may be stored as the first standby home information of the target IP. After the target IP uses the first standby attribution information, if the network transmission quality of the target IP does not meet the triggering condition any more, namely the quality is improved, the attribution information of the target IP is modified into the first standby attribution information. And if the target IP still meets the trigger condition after the first standby attribution information is used, namely the quality is not improved, restoring the attribution information of the target IP to the original attribution information.
In some embodiments, after the target IP uses the first standby attribution information, the target IP still satisfies the above-mentioned trigger condition, that is, the quality is not improved, except that the attribution information of the target IP is restored to the original attribution information, the reference servers after the first priority can be sequentially selected according to the priorities from high to low to modify the attribution information of the target IP, so that the network transmission quality of the modified target IP does not satisfy the trigger condition.
In addition, before the usage record is queried in step 220, it may be determined whether the network transmission quality of the target IP used by other users or the network transmission quality of other IPs in the same IP subnet as the target IP meets the trigger condition, and step 220 is executed if the network transmission quality meets the trigger condition. This is because if another user uses the target IP, the network has no quality problem, which means that the network transmission quality of the target user using the target IP is not good due to another reason, and therefore, it is not necessary to correct the attribution information of the target IP. However, considering that the probability that the same IP is allocated to more than two users within the preset time is relatively small, as described above, the IP attribution information in the same IP subnet is the same, so when the network transmission quality of other users using other IPs in the same IP subnet as the target IP does not meet the trigger condition, i.e., the network quality is relatively good, it is described that the IP attribution information in the IP subnet is correct, i.e., the target user using the target IP is a problem in the network quality because the attribution information is not wrong, and therefore, the attribution information of the target IP does not need to be corrected.
According to the IP library correction method provided by the invention, based on the fact that the geographical position of the target user is not changed within the preset time, when the network transmission quality of the target IP used by the target user meets the trigger condition, the target IP is corrected by using the reference IP home information which is in a different IP subnet with the target IP or a server which serves an operator different from the operator to which the target IP belongs, so that the home information correction can be effectively and quickly carried out on the IP with poor network transmission quality.
